We’re excited to announce that we are seeking a General Manager for the State of Illinois! The General Manager is responsible for building, developing, and leading a High Performing Team responsible for achieving operations and revenue goals in our cultivation and retail facilities throughout the state. This role also has full P&L responsibility for assigned sites and oversees both strategy and tactics for the aimed at achieving operational goals!
Responsibilities
o Oversees all aspects of the customer value chain within an assigned state including inventory, distribution, and retail operations.
o Translates business and operational strategies into actionable short and long-term plans and establishes performance objectives for assigned teams
o Develops and executes short- and long-term financial strategies
o Manages P&L and delivers against established budget and EBITDA targets
o Drives operational performance and ensures all projects and tasks are completed in accordance with established plans
o Partners with wholesale, retail, and SME teams to ensure sales and profitability goals are attained
o Partners with regional compliance representatives to ensure all operations are compliant with state regulations
o Builds strong community relationships with elected officials, regulators, community leaders and the medical community.
o Leads business operations including the creation and execution of SOPs, management of budgets, identification of best practices and the creation of policies and practices
o Maintains effective working relationships with national team partners including Finance and Accounting, Marketing, Compliance, and Human Resources
o Responsible for operating in full compliance with all state and local guidelines for all assigned locations
o Identifies potential risks and communicates mitigation strategies in a timely and effective manner.
o Continually identifies and implements business process improvements
Requirements
o Bachelor’s Degree or equivalent combination of relevant experience
o 7 or more years of experience leading operations in highly regulated industry
o 5 or more years of experience leading and developing a large team of individuals across multiple disciplines
o Working knowledge across multiple business functions, including operations, sales, supply chain, etc.
o Prior Cannabis industry experience preferred
o Demonstrated leadership skills with a broad knowledge of management practices

Position Summary:
The Dispensary Manager is responsible for leading their assigned dispensary, ensuring an exceptional customer experience, maintaining a highly engaged and positive team culture, and meeting company defined revenue targets. This role oversees all sales and service, business operations, and cash and inventory management. This position also ensures, consistent SOPs, training and development for all assigned Team Members and ensures regulatory compliance.
Summary of Essential Functions and Responsibilities
Management Responsibilities:
- Responsible for interviewing, hiring, on-boarding, training, and managing dispensary staff for all assigned locations
- Oversees dispensary work schedules to ensure adequate staffing to meet customer volume and demand
- Ensures on-going team training and development for assigned team members
- Conducts regular meetings with assigned employees to assess KPI, goal, and task performance, and identify developmental opportunities
- Collaborates with Retail Trainer and Supply Chain Manager to ensure on-going staff training on products, product usage methods, properties of cannabis, cannabinoids, and terpenes
- Utilizes reward and recognition programs to recognize exceptional employee performance
- Addresses HR matters and employee relations issues swiftly and strategically with the HR Team
- Promotes effective communication amongst all assigned teams and ensures national leadership is briefed on key employee issues impacting operations.
- Regularly monitors P&L and strategizes on the achievement of outlined KPI’s including but not limited to sales, customer service, inventory levels, payroll cost, profitability, and EBITA.
- Implements operational procedures in compliance with applicable state regulations; and ensures legislative and procedural changes relating to the sales and distribution of cannabis are clearly communicated and trained to dispensary staff
- Collaborates with Finance and Accounting to manage vendor payments including submission and approval of invoices and prioritizing invoices for payment
- Manages till for each POS location, coordinates with Accounting on cash requirements for store operations
- Responsible for accurate and efficient inventory tracking
- Ensures adherence to inventory related SOPs in order to promote reporting consistency, mitigate loss, and remain compliant with applicable regulations
- Oversees Supply Chain Manager to ensure adequate stock levels, proper product assortment, and consistent replenishment
- Ensures cash in store is regularly counted, cross-checked, and balanced
- Collaborates with accounting and finance to ensure adequate cash and change is on-hand to facilitate sales and transactions
- Holds team accountable for consistent and accurate cash handling practices
- Collaborates with Compliance to meet state reporting requirements (sales, inventory and quarterly reports)
- Maintains up to date knowledge on state regulations and ensures all team members are properly trained on changes or additions to policy
- Collaborates with the State Security Manager to define policies, practices, and procedures
